Navigational stars (1939 – 1945 Silent hunter 5)

Latitudes (ϕ)
Declination
for the altitude (h) measurements
of the stars upper culmination Star (δ)
True azimuth 180° True azimuth 0° ° ʹ
X X X 74 <--- 1 Polaris + 89 15,7
N ---> 71 41 <--- -32 Alioth + 56 13,7
N ---> 60 30 <--- -43 Capella + 45 56,8
«Blind spot» at the zenith ϕ = δ ± 15°

N ---> 60 30 <--- -43 Deneb + 45 6,1


N ---> 53 23 <--- -50 Vega + 38 44,6
N ---> 43 13 <--- -60 Alpheratz + 28 48,8
N ---> 43 13 <--- -60 Pollux + 28 8,7
N ---> 34 4 <--- -69 Arcturus + 19 25,3
N ---> 31 1 <--- -72 Aldebaran + 16 24,4
N ---> 27 -3 <--- -76 Regulus + 12 12,8
N ---> 23 -7 <--- -80 Altair + 8 44,7
N ---> 22 -8 <--- -81 Betelgeuse + 7 23,9
N ---> 20 -10 <--- -83 Procyon + 5 20,4
80 ---> 7 -23 <--- S Rigel ‒ 8 15,5
78 ---> 5 -25 <--- S Spica ‒ 10 54,1
72 ---> -1 -31 <--- S Sirius ‒ 16 40,1
62 ---> -11 -41 <--- S Antares ‒ 26 19,1
59 ---> -14 -44 <--- S Fomalhaut ‒ 29 53,1
36 ---> -37 -67 <--- S Canopus ‒ 52 40,0
31 ---> -42 -72 <--- S Achernar ‒ 57 29,7
26 ---> -47 -77 <--- S Acrux ‒ 62 49,7
ϕ = δ + 90° ‒ h ϕ = δ + h ‒ 90°
